Nature Abhors a Vacuum

Advice to world leaders, seeking regime change in countries other than their own.

When invading countries, on the pretext of helping the local population rid themselves of the incumbent regime, ensure that the following two rules are adhered to:

  • Make sure that you have a plan for the reconstruction, and repair, of any damage caused.


  • Don't "cut and run", until the local replacement political and security infrastructure is strong enough to stand on its own two feet.

Nature abhors a vacuum; if you leave before the above points have been addressed others will fill the vacuum, and chaos will ensue.
